Specifications and assembly | Secretlab Magnus Review

Here are some specifics of the desk that are essential to know in order to appreciate its usability. 

  • Length: 150 Cm
  • Height: 73.5 Cm 
  • Depth: 70 Cm
  • Maximum load weight: 100 Kg (25 for the back cover) 
  • Other: magnetic top, cable tray, assembly kit included

During the assembly phase, the instructions provided were fundamental: really very clear, thanks to complete and exhaustive drawings.

La care some details it is noted as soon as the package is opened. Every part of the desk is packed e divided to the perfection so that nothing can be damaged even during transport. In addition to great instructions It was really a welcome thing to find a complete assembly kit. Although it is not necessary to have a hardware to assemble the desk, finding the screwdriver with the various interchangeable heads inside the package has greatly facilitated the assembly. 


By following the illustrations and tips for the mounting in two people we have dedicated a little more than twenty minutes to assemble and position our desk. Ironically, the part that made us waste the most time was not the editing itself but being able to match the mat di leatherette upholstery (also magnetic) with the piano. After a couple of unsuccessful attempts we managed to get the desired result.

Comfort and use | Secretlab Magnus Review

Although the dimensions are not abundant, we were able to easily place all our setup on the plane. Thanks to monitor fixed on the wall we were able to install a Creative Stage V2 soundbar with annex subwoofer, a large case like the Corsair iCUE 5000T RGB, obviously all followed by a keyboard and mouse included. 


In short, despite a large PC and a bulky audio system due to the speaker and subwoofer combo, we were able to better manage the available space. 


I adjustable feet a few centimeters also help to position the desk according to your comfort and smooth out any height difference if you already have another work table placed in the immediate vicinity. 

La coverage in leatherette does not allow one slip correct mouse (not at best if nothing else) therefore our advice is to place a mat for the latter device.
